The Presenting tab provides designated team members with the ability to add, edit, and view information that was provided when the case was referred to the CAC. The information on the Presenting Tab is typically complete even before the Forensic Interview is conducted. It is designed to record what is known about the case at the time the report is made – how the case presented initially.

The Presenting Tab is divided into several sections and record tables. Red data fields in this tab are used to tabulate statistics for the NCA Statistics Report.

The Save and Cancel buttons for the tab are located in the header above the active page. You must select “Save” to save information entered into each section to the case record. These buttons will be available even if you are at the bottom of the page.

The Presenting tab also has a “Save as Permanent Record” button. Once this option is selected, no further changes can be made to the record on the Presenting tab and data in this tab will be set to read-only.

Referral

The referral section includes information from the initial report or referral form.

STEP 1: Enter Date

Start by entering the date the CAC was made aware of the case in the field “Date Received by CAC.”

image

Figure 2. “Date Received by CAC” field

STEP 2: Enter the Referring Agency

Select the agency that made the referral from the “Referral Source” drop down list.

image

Figure 3. “Referral Source” drop down list

To add a new Agency, click on the “Add” button next to the Referral Source field.

image

Figure 4. “Add” referral source button

The “New Agency” dialog box will appear with a list of existing agencies at the top. Check to make sure the agency you want to add is not in the list. If it is on the list, select it there and return to the Incoming Referral section. If it is not on the list, enter the agency name, address and phone number in the open fields. Click “Save” to add the new agency or “Cancel” to forego adding a new agency.

image

Figure 5. “New Agency” fields

STEP 3: Enter the Individual Making the Referral

After you have chosen the Referral Source, the dropdown list for the “Person” field will be populated with personnel from the selected agency. Choose the individual who made the referral from the “Person” dropdown list.

image

Figure 6. “Person” dropdown list

To add a new personnel for the chosen agency, click on the “Add” button next to the Person field.

image

Figure 7. “Add” person button

The “New Personnel” dialog box will appear with a list of existing individuals associated with the selected agency. Check to make sure the person you want to add is not in the list. If they are on the list, click cancel to return to the Referral section and select them from the Person drop down box. If the individual does not appear in the list, enter the individual’s name, credentials, job title, email address and phone number, if known. First and last names are required. Click “Save” to add the new person or “Cancel” to forego adding a new person.

image

Figure 8. “New Personnel” list of existing individuals and new personnel data fields

STEP 4: Enter the Reason for Referral

Select the “Reason for Referral” from the radio button options. Once you tick on “Allegation of Abuse,” “Requesting Other Direct Services”, or “Requesting Other Indirect Services”, new fields and selections will be available for you to enter more information about the case.

Incident

The incident section includes more details about the location where the incident(s) allegedly occurred.

Use the “Location Description” open text field to record a description of the incident location.

Select the “State” and “County” where the incident(s) took place from the drop down lists.

Select the “Location Type” from the options in the drop down list.

Use the “Narrative Description” open text field to record a synopsis of how the allegation was initially made and the case referred to the CAC.

Prior Interviews

The Prior Interviews table provides a place to record if a child has already been interviewed with respect to this case.

image

Figure 11. Prior Interviews table

STEP 1: Add a Prior Interview

To document a prior interview, click on the “Add New Record” button.

image

Figure 12. “Add New Record” button

Enter the date the conversation/interview took place in the “Interview Date” field and the “Agency” that conducted the interview.

image

Figure 13. “Interview Date” and “Agency” fields

Click “Update” to save the record. Click “Cancel” to forego adding a new record.

STEP 2: Edit or Delete a Prior Interview

To edit a prior interview record, click on the “Edit” button in the row next to the record you wish to modify.

If you wish to delete a prior interview, click the “Delete” button in the row with the record you wish to remove.

image

Figure 14. “Edit” and “Delete” buttons

A pop up box will ask, “Are you sure you want to delete this record?” to confirm deletion. Select

“OK” to delete, or “Cancel” to forego deleting the record.

Document Upload

To upload documents related to the information entered on the Presenting Tab, go to the Document Upload section towards the bottom of the page.

Refer to the “Document Upload” help file for details on uploading and managing documents.

NOTE: NCA does not recommend the storage of evidentiary documents as part of this case record. Any copies of evidentiary materials should be retained by the appropriate law enforcement and prosecution partners.
